adptrCommunityTable
CISCO-ADAPTER-MIB ·
.1.3.6.1.4.1.9.5.2.4
Object
table mandatory
The adapter community table (4 entries). This table lists community strings and their access levels. When an SNMP message is received by this adapter, the community string in the message is compared with this table to determine access rights of the sender.

Net-SNMP examples
How SNMP and these commands workUse a bulk walk to inspect objects and instances beneath this OID.
Walk the subtree
/usr/bin/snmpbulkwalk -v2c -c '<community>' -Pud -Ir -OQUs -m 'CISCO-ADAPTER-MIB' -M '/opt/observium/mibs/cisco:/opt/observium/mibs/rfc:/opt/observium/mibs/net-snmp' 'udp:<hostname>:161' 'CISCO-ADAPTER-MIB::adptrCommunityTable'
More examples
Translate to a numeric OID
/usr/bin/snmptranslate -Pud -Ir -On -m 'CISCO-ADAPTER-MIB' -M '/opt/observium/mibs/cisco:/opt/observium/mibs/rfc:/opt/observium/mibs/net-snmp' 'CISCO-ADAPTER-MIB::adptrCommunityTable'
